From source file:org.archive.crawler.fetcher.FetchFTP.java

/**
 * Fetches a document from an FTP server.
 * /*  w  w w .  j  a  v a2  s.  c o  m*/
 * @param curi      the URI of the document to fetch
 * @param client    the FTPClient to use for the fetch
 * @param recorder  the recorder to preserve the document in
 * @throws IOException  if a network or protocol error occurs
 * @throws InterruptedException  if the thread is interrupted
 */
private void fetch(CrawlURI curi, ClientFTP client, HttpRecorder recorder)
        throws IOException, InterruptedException {
    // Connect to the FTP server.
    UURI uuri = curi.getUURI();
    int port = uuri.getPort();
    if (port == -1) {
        port = 21;
    }

    client.connect(uuri.getHost(), port);

    // Authenticate.
    String[] auth = getAuth(curi);
    client.login(auth[0], auth[1]);

    // The given resource may or may not be a directory.
    // To figure out which is which, execute a CD command to
    // the UURI's path.  If CD works, it's a directory.
    boolean isDirectory = client.changeWorkingDirectory(uuri.getPath());

    // Get a data socket.  This will either be the result of a NLST
    // command for a directory, or a RETR command for a file.
    int command;
    String path;
    if (isDirectory) {
        curi.addAnnotation("ftpDirectoryList");
        command = FTPCommand.NLST;
        client.setFileType(FTP.ASCII_FILE_TYPE);
        path = ".";
    } else {
        command = FTPCommand.RETR;
        client.setFileType(FTP.BINARY_FILE_TYPE);
        path = uuri.getPath();
    }

    client.enterLocalPassiveMode();
    Socket socket = null;

    try {
        socket = client.openDataConnection(command, path);

        // if "227 Entering Passive Mode" these will get reset later
        curi.setFetchStatus(client.getReplyCode());
        curi.putString(A_FTP_FETCH_STATUS, client.getReplyStrings()[0]);

    } catch (IOException e) {
        // try it again, see AbstractFrontier.needsRetrying()
        curi.setFetchStatus(S_CONNECT_LOST);
    }

    // Save the streams in the CURI, where downstream processors
    // expect to find them.
    if (socket != null) {
        // Shall we get a digest on the content downloaded?
        boolean digestContent = ((Boolean) getUncheckedAttribute(curi, FetchHTTP.ATTR_DIGEST_CONTENT))
                .booleanValue();
        String algorithm = null;
        if (digestContent) {
            algorithm = ((String) getUncheckedAttribute(curi, FetchHTTP.ATTR_DIGEST_ALGORITHM));
            recorder.getRecordedInput().setDigest(algorithm);
            recorder.getRecordedInput().startDigest();
        } else {
            // clear
            recorder.getRecordedInput().setDigest((MessageDigest) null);
        }

        try {
            saveToRecorder(curi, socket, recorder);
        } finally {
            recorder.close();
            client.closeDataConnection(); // does socket.close()
            curi.setContentSize(recorder.getRecordedInput().getSize());

            // "226 Transfer complete."
            client.getReply();
            curi.setFetchStatus(client.getReplyCode());
            curi.putString(A_FTP_FETCH_STATUS, client.getReplyStrings()[0]);

            if (isDirectory) {
                curi.setContentType("text/plain");
            } else {
                curi.setContentType("application/octet-stream");
            }

            if (logger.isLoggable(Level.INFO)) {
                logger.info("read " + recorder.getRecordedInput().getSize() + " bytes from ftp data socket");
            }

            if (digestContent) {
                curi.setContentDigest(algorithm, recorder.getRecordedInput().getDigestValue());
            }
        }

        if (isDirectory) {
            extract(curi, recorder);
        }
    }

    addParent(curi);
}

/*******************************************
                     *//from  w w  w.j a v  a 2 s  . c  o m
                     *   Sets the use of binary mode for file transfers if passed true, 
                     *   ASCII mode if passed false.  
                     */
public void setBinaryMode(boolean useBinaryMode) throws IOException {
    if (useBinaryMode) {
        log.debug("setting BINARY mode for file transfers");
        setFileType(FTP.BINARY_FILE_TYPE);
    } else {
        log.debug("setting ASCII mode for file transfers");
        setFileType(FTP.ASCII_FILE_TYPE);
    }
}
